For an engagement ring, I would buy the diamond from a PS vendor such as Whiteflash. It's easier if you have them set it as well unless you want a custom setting, and then there are great options such as Victor Canera and Caysie van Bebber.

You may not find the diamond quality in Chicago that we are accustomed to around here. I have bought a band from Ivy and Rose, but I can't say I'd go there for an engagement ring. Dimend Scaasi used to be on the forum years ago and had some nice quality settings, if that is what you are wanting to look at. But I'd still order the diamond from one of the superideal vendors if you want a round.
